Laurie Anderson Collaboration to Premiere at Park Avenue Armory Next Month

Park Avenue Armory premieres a penetrating new work this fall developed by Laurie Anderson in collaboration with Mohammed el Gharani, a former Guantanamo Bay detainee. HABEAS CORPUS, commissioned by the Armory, expands on Anderson's fusing of storytelling and technology, creating an installation and performance piece that examines lost identity, memory, and the resiliency of the human body and spirit. The work premieres for three days and nights, October 2-4, 2015.

The Actors' Temple Announces ARTS @ AT Series, with Comedy, Music & More

In celebrating the New Year 5776, The Actors' Temple, founded in 1917 and located in a landmark building in the heart of the theater district since 1923, introduces a new initiative ARTS @ AT, to reinforce their historic commitment to serving Jewish theater artists and maintaining a relationship with the surrounding NYC arts community. Sophie Tucker, Red Buttons, Jack Benny and the Three Stooges are among the scores of well-known entertainers who frequented its striking halls. The Actors' Temple is located at 339 West 47th Street, between 8th and 9th Avenue.

PHANTOM BODIES: THE HUMAN AURA IN ART Exhibition to Open 10/30 at Frist Center

The third in a series of exhibitions about the human body in contemporary art organized by Frist Center Chief Curator Mark Scala, PHANTOM BODIES: THE HUMAN AURA IN ART includes provocative artworks that address themes of trauma, loss, and transformation, while considering the possibility of an animating spirit that can exist independently of the body. The exhibition includes a selection of paintings, photography, videos, sculpture and installations by a noteworthy roster of contemporary international artists and will be on view in the Upper-Level Galleries from October 30, 2015, through February 14, 2016.

UNCLE VANYA to Run 10/15-12/6 at Antaeus

Anton Chekhov's Uncle Vanya bursts with passion and fierce humor in Pulitzer Prize and three-time Obie Award-winning playwright Annie Baker's colloquial translation, adapted from a literal translation by Margarita Shalina and the original Russian text. The Antaeus Theatre Company presents the West Coast premiere of Baker's fresh new version, hailed as one of the top 10 shows of 2012 by both The New York Times and New York magazine, in a fully partner-cast production. Robin Larsen directs for an October 15 opening at the Antaeus Theater in NoHo, with low-priced previews beginning October 8.

Full Cast Announced for Zany ZinZanni's Fall Cabaret-Cirque Concoction 'Hollywood Nights'

Teatro ZinZanni Seattle today announced the royal flush cast of its fall creation Hollywood Nights - a three-hour whirlwind of love, chaos and dinner served up à la cirque, comedy, and cabaret. Hollywood Nights will feature the long-awaited return of prolific actor and fun-slinger Ron Campbell as well as absurd visual comedian Mr. P.P. Filling out another international cast of unique talents is chanteuse Francine Reed, aerial trapeze artists Ben Wendel (of Duo Madrona) and Terry Crane, opera diva Juliana Rambaldi, master juggler Gamal David Garcia, vaudevillian Wayne Doba, acrobat-dancer Andrea Conway Doba, gorgeous gymnast Elena Gatilova and Chinese Pole acrobat Domitil Aillot. Hollywood Nights is set to open September 17, 2015 (press night Thursday, October 1, 2015) and run through January 31, 2016 at Teatro ZinZanni (222 Mercer Street, Seattle).

MoMA to Open Eastern European & Latin American Art Exhibition 'TRANSMISSIONS' This Fall

The Museum of Modern Art presents Transmissions: Art in Eastern Europe and Latin America, 1960-1980, an exhibition on view from September 5, 2015, through January 3, 2016, that focuses on the parallels and connections among international artists working in-and in reference to-Latin America and Eastern Europe during the 1960s and 1970s.
